So, how do you get started? First, you must figure out what time of day works best for you to pray. Some people like to start their day by praying, and others prefer to pray before going to going to bed. Experiment and see which method works best for you.

Once you’ve determined the best time for prayer You can begin to build your routine. Here’s an example of a pattern that you can follow daily for morning prayers:

Begin by talking to God, ask for his blessing while you read and pray.

Read a passage from the Bible and reflect on the passage. This can be done by reading it three to four times, or listing the things it says about yourself or guidelines to obey , or promises to keep.

Make your prayer a ritual by praying for adoration, confession as well as petition and thanksgiving. Pray for your immediate needs and worries and then take time to enjoy God’s presence.

The great thing about the prayer time routine is that it’s customizable to meet your requirements. For some, you may have only a few minutes to spare, while others may have a half an hour or more. The key is making it a consistent part of your routine. If you fall off the occasional day or two do not fret! Just get back on track for the next day.

Another way to increase your prayer practice is to create a more interactive. Instead of simply reciting phrases, try engaging with God at a deeper level. Try using your imagination to imagine the scenes that are described within the Bible. You can try to imagine the feelings of these characters and place yourself in their shoes. This can make your time in prayer more meaningful and personal.

Try incorporating different types in your prayer day-to-day routine. For example, try silent prayer, contemplative prayer or even journaling your prayers. This can keep your prayer routine from becoming monotonous and add the variety you need to your spiritual practice.

One of the most effective ways to stay engaged and focused on your prayer practice is by sharing your practice with others. Find a partner in accountability, a friend or family member who will be checking on you regularly and help you to adhere to your daily routine. They can even be a part of your prayers and share their own experiences.
